Aniebiet Inyang Ntui is a woman whose name is synonymous with climate advocacy. As the Ambassador of the EU's European Climate Pact, she has taken on the crucial role of spearheading efforts to combat climate change. Her passion and dedication towards environmental sustainability are indeed commendable and have not gone unnoticed. In her various capacities, Professor Aniebiet Inyang Ntui has been a vocal advocate for climate action. Her wealth of knowledge and experience has made her a valuable resource in international climate negotiations. She has chaired panels at major global climate conferences, including the 2022 United Nations Climate Change Conference, the G20 Bali Summit, and the United Nations Water Summit on Groundwater. Her advocacy as a Member of the UNCBD Women's Caucus, led to a Rio Convention for the first time in its 30-year history to adopt a stand-alone target on gender equality in the Kunming-Montreal Global Biodiversity Framework during the 2022 United Nations Biodiversity Conference. Apart from her work in climate advocacy, Aniebiet Inyang Ntui has also contributed significantly to literacy advocacy and library development in her native Nigeria. She currently serves as the University Librarian of the University of Calabar. Her efforts in promoting literacy and library development have had a positive impact on the education sector in Nigeria. Aniebiet Inyang Ntui has received several accolades and recognition for her work, including being named by the Web of Science as the "Most Read Researcher in Nigeria." Her publications on literacy, climate and biodiversity conservation have been widely cited, and her expertise in the field has made her a sought-after speaker at international conferences and events. Ingmar Rentzhog is the founder & CEO of We Don’t Have Time, the world's largest review platform for the climate with the mission to empower everyday individuals and to push those in power to do more. Mr Rentzhog was born and raised in Ås, outside Östersund in Northern Sweden. He studied mathematics at Uppsala University, before founding the financial communication company Laika Consulting AB in 2004. Out of frustration that world leaders did not act on the climate crisis, Ingmar founded We Don’t Have Time with his colleague David Olsson in 2017. One year later, Mr Rentzhog sold Laika Consulting to be able to focus on scaling up We Don’t Have Time. In 2018, We Don’t Have Time created the world’s first no-fly digital climate conference, to prove it was possible to run a global show without emitting tons of carbon. Since then, the company has hosted a large number of climate events and broadcast series, including daily live broadcasts at the United Nations Climate Conference 2021 United Nations Climate Change Conference in Glasgow, in November 2021. The We Don't Have Time broadcasts reach millions of viewers from over 100 countries. Ingmar Rentzhog is a The Climate Reality Project, personally trained by Climate Reality founder, Nobel Laureate and former US vice president Al Gore. Since 2022 Ingmar Rentzhog is a European Climate Pact Ambassador. Launched by the European Commission, the Climate Pact is part of the European Green Deal and is helping the European Union to meet its goal to be the first climate-neutral continent in the world by 2050. Since March 2018 Mr Rentzhog is also a member of the European Climate Policy Task Force. The Team provides important support to strengthen positive European policy efforts on the EU level. Ingmar Rentzhog has been the chairman of the environmental think tank Global Utmaning (Global Challenge) and a board member of the investment crowdfunding platform FundedByMe. He is currently on the board of Naventus Corporate Finance
